推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文详细介绍了在VPS上搭建PostgreSQL数据库的过程,从基础知识到高级应用,帮助读者从入门到精通。还介绍了如何在VPS上搭建梯子软件,以提高网络安全性和隐私保护。文章内容全面,步骤清晰,适合Linux操作系统用户参考。
本文目录导读:
随着互联网技术的不断发展,数据库在各类项目中扮演着越来越重要的角色,作为一种功能强大、开源的数据库管理系统,PostgreSQL受到了越来越多开发者和企业的青睐,而在使用PostgreSQL的过程中,如何在VPS上搭建和管理它成为一个亟待解决的问题,本文将为您详细介绍如何在VPS上搭建PostgreSQL,带您从入门到精通。
VPS简介
VPS(Virtual Private Server)即虚拟专用服务器,是将一台物理服务器通过虚拟化技术分割成多个隔离的虚拟服务器,相较于共享主机,VPS具有更高的性能、安全性和自由度,可以满足各类网站和应用的需求。
PostgreSQL简介
PostgreSQL是一种功能强大的开源对象-关系型数据库管理系统(ORDBMS),它具有支持多种数据类型、强大的查询功能、良好的扩展性、事务安全等优点,PostgreSQL遵循开源协议,可以在各种操作系统上运行,广泛应用于各类项目。
VPS搭建PostgreSQL的步骤
1、购买VPS
您需要在一家可靠的云服务提供商处购买一台VPS,建议选择性能较高、带宽较大的VPS,以满足PostgreSQL的运行需求,在购买过程中,可以选择Linux或Windows操作系统,虽然Windows系统的价格稍高,但它能提供更好的图形界面管理体验。
2、配置VPS
在获得VPS后,需要对其进行基本配置,具体步骤如下:
(1)连接VPS:通过SSH或远程桌面连接到您的VPS。
(2)更新系统:为了确保系统安全性和稳定性,建议及时更新系统,在Linux系统上,可以使用以下命令更新:
sudo apt-get update sudo apt-get upgrade
在Windows系统上,可以通过“控制面板”->“系统和安全”->“Windows更新”进行更新。
(3)安装PostgreSQL:根据您的操作系统,选择合适的安装方法。
2、安装PostgreSQL
在Linux系统上,可以使用包管理器安装PostgreSQL,以下以Ubuntu为例:
sudo apt-get update sudo apt-get install postgresql
在Windows系统上,您可以下载PostgreSQL的安装包进行安装。
3、初始化PostgreSQL
安装完成后,需要对PostgreSQL进行初始化,在Linux系统上,可以使用以下命令:
sudo -u postgres initdb /var/lib/postgresql/data/ -E utf8
在Windows系统上,初始化过程会在安装过程中自动完成。
4、配置PostgreSQL
为了确保PostgreSQL的安全性和稳定性,需要对其进行一些配置,具体步骤如下:
(1)修改PostgreSQL配置文件:在Linux系统上,配置文件位于/etc/postgresql/版本/main/postgresql.cOnf
,您可以根据需求修改以下参数:
listen_addresses = '*' port = 5432 max_connections = 100
(2)设置PostgreSQL数据目录:在Linux系统上,数据目录位于/var/lib/postgresql/数据/
,您可以根据需求更改数据目录。
(3)创建PostgreSQL用户和数据库:使用以下命令创建一个新用户和一个新数据库:
sudo -u postgres createuser 用户名 sudo -u postgres createdb 数据库名 用户名
5、启动和停止PostgreSQL
启动PostgreSQL:
sudo systemctl start postgresql
停止PostgreSQL:
sudo systemctl stop postgresql
VPS管理PostgreSQL
1、登录PostgreSQL
使用以下命令登录PostgreSQL:
sudo -u 用户名 psql
2、创建和删除数据库
创建数据库:
CREATE DATABASE 数据库名;
删除数据库:
DROP DATABASE 数据库名;
3、创建和管理表空间
创建表空间:
CREATE TABLESPACE 表空间名 LOCATION '/path/to/tablespace';
删除表空间:
DROP TABLESPACE 表空间名;
4、备份和恢复数据
备份数据:
pg_dump 数据库名 > 数据库名.backup
恢复数据:
psql 数据库名 < 数据库名.backup
本文从VPS简介、PostgreSQL简介、VPS搭建PostgreSQL的步骤、VPS管理PostgreSQL等方面,详细介绍了如何在VPS上搭建和管理PostgreSQL,希望本文能为您在使用PostgreSQL过程中提供有益的帮助。
相关关键词:VPS, PostgreSQL, 数据库, 开源, 虚拟专用服务器, 对象-关系型数据库管理系统, 安装, 配置, 初始化, 管理, 备份, 恢复
本文标签属性:
VPS搭建PostgreSQL:vps搭建节点